FROG MAN Posted November 22, 2009 #1 Posted November 22, 2009 OK guys yesterday at some point I lost both rear brake lights on my 04 silverado. I drove the last 300 miles with my daughter tailing me tight with her Subaru just to make it here.I believe I have a wiring problem. The brake fuse is fine,tail light bulbs are fine, and the third brake light that sets high above the rear glass works OK. This tells me the brake light switch is OK.The ground to both rear tail lights is probably OK as the rear turn signals,park lights etc are OK. I'm thinking maybe the master feed line comes into some connection plugs under the frame behind rear bumper. I'll check it out today when it warms up here. I got my volt meter with me just no wiring diagram.Those rear electrical plugs may be corroded.Nothing like plenty to do on vacation.
